Stone wall hardscaping services involve the construction and installation of durable, aesthetically appealing stone walls on residential properties. These walls can serve multiple purposes, such as defining property boundaries, creating privacy, or adding visual interest to outdoor spaces. Skilled contractors typically work with a variety of natural stones, including limestone, sandstone, and fieldstone, to design structures that blend seamlessly with the property's landscape. The process often includes careful planning, site preparation, and precise stacking or mortar application to ensure stability and longevity.

This type of hardscaping can address several common property concerns. For example, stone walls can help prevent soil erosion on sloped land, providing a stable barrier that keeps gardens and lawns intact. They also serve as effective privacy screens or windbreaks, reducing noise and creating a more secluded outdoor environment. Additionally, stone walls can act as retaining walls to manage water runoff and improve drainage, especially in areas prone to flooding or pooling. These features make stone wall services a practical solution for homeowners seeking both functional and attractive outdoor enhancements.

Properties that typically utilize stone wall hardscaping include residential yards, estates, and properties with uneven terrain. Homes with sloped landscapes often benefit from retaining walls that create level terraces for gardening or outdoor living spaces. Larger properties or those with distinctive architectural styles may incorporate stone walls to add character and curb appeal. Even smaller yards can benefit from the visual and functional advantages of stone walls, especially when space is limited and privacy is desired. The overview below groups typical Stone Wall Hardscaping projects into broad ranges so you can see how smaller, mid-sized, and larger jobs often compare in your area.

In many markets, a large share of routine jobs stays in the lower and middle ranges, while only a smaller percentage of projects moves into the highest bands when the work is more complex or site conditions are harder than average.

Smaller Repairs - Typical costs for small stone wall repairs or patchwork usually range from $250-$600. Many routine fixes fall within this middle range, depending on the extent of damage and materials used.

Mid-Size Projects - Installing a new stone retaining wall or garden boundary often costs between $1,500-$4,000. Larger, more detailed projects can push beyond this range, but most fall within this band.

Large-Scale Installations - Complete stone wall installations for larger areas or complex designs typically range from $4,000-$10,000. These projects often involve more materials and labor, leading to higher costs.

Full Replacement or Custom Designs - Full removal and replacement of existing walls or custom, intricate designs can reach $10,000+ in many cases. Fewer projects fall into this highest tier, as they involve extensive work and specialized craftsmanship.

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.

When comparing local contractors for stone wall hardscaping, it’s important to evaluate their experience with similar projects. Homeowners should inquire about how long the service providers have been working in the area and whether they have completed projects comparable in scope and style. A contractor’s familiarity with different stone types, design techniques, and site conditions can influence the quality and durability of the finished wall. Reviewing portfolios or asking for examples of past work can provide insight into their expertise and help determine if their experience aligns with the homeowner’s vision.

Clear written expectations are essential for a successful project. Homeowners should seek detailed proposals that outline the scope of work, materials to be used, and the approximate steps involved. Having these details in writing helps prevent misunderstandings and provides a reference point throughout the project. Service providers who communicate their plans clearly and are transparent about processes tend to foster smoother collaborations and ensure that all parties are aligned on project goals.

Reputable references and effective communication are also key factors to consider when choosing local contractors. Homeowners should ask for references from previous clients to gain insight into the contractor’s reliability, professionalism, and quality of work. Additionally, good communication-such as prompt responses to questions and willingness to discuss ideas-can make the process more straightforward and less stressful. Ultimately, selecting a service provider with a solid reputation and open lines of communication can contribute to a positive experience and a successful stone wall project.

What types of stone wall services do local contractors provide? Local contractors typically offer design, installation, and repair services for various types of stone walls, including retaining walls, garden walls, and decorative features.

How can I ensure the stone wall complements my landscape? Consulting with local pros can help select styles, materials, and finishes that match your existing landscape and personal preferences.

Are there different stone options available for wall construction? Yes, local service providers often work with a variety of stones such as limestone, granite, fieldstone, and veneer to suit different aesthetic and functional needs.

What maintenance is needed for stone walls installed by local contractors? Proper drainage, occasional cleaning, and inspections for damage are common maintenance tasks handled by local pros to keep stone walls in good condition.

How do local contractors handle custom stone wall designs? They work with clients to develop personalized plans that incorporate specific styles, sizes, and layouts to meet individual project goals.
